Improve your wellbeing using these 4 easy steps

Improve your wellbeing quote

Staying healthy can be a challenge nowadays. Long workdays, spending time with your family, and taking care of chores around the house can all become too much that you never have time to take care of yourself. But there are 4 simple things you can do in your everyday life to improve your wellbeing and health. You may be surprised by how much more energy you have and how better you feel by implementing these changes to your routine.

1. Drink more water

The human body is more than 70% water and for a good reason. Your body uses up a lot of water just to keep the organs going, and if you’re not regularly staying hydrated, then your organs will start to suffer.

Drinking water is the purest form of hydration, so even if those coffees and sodas are tempting, switch them out for water on a more regular basis. You’ll actually start to lose weight, improve the state of your teeth, and save more money.

2. More fruits and vegetables

It can be faster and cheaper to hit the drive-thru to get a quick meal at lunchtime, but what money you save now you’ll have to spend later taking care of your health. Adding more vegetables and fruits to each meal will make you feel full for a lot longer and keep you regular.

The addition of fruits and veggies also provides your body with the vitamins and minerals that it needs to function at its best. You can aid the process of your gut with some blue biotics to get the right flora conditions for digestion.

3. Sleeping better to improve your wellbeing

Staying up and reading your favorite book or watching a Youtube video isn’t the best way to treat your body or your mind. Just as your body gets tired, your brain needs a break too, and that’s what sleep does for you.

It provides it with the means to stop working for a while so that it can be more energized for tomorrow. Do your best to get enough sleep each night so that your body can properly repair itself and then you can be ready for tomorrow’s challenges.

4. Wash your hands

There are germs everywhere in the world, and you can minimize your risk of getting sick by washing your hands before you start to eat food, after you’ve used the bathroom (public or private), and as soon as you get home from running errands. Eliminating the risk of those germs being spread means that you have fewer chances of getting sick, even in your own home.

Try to wash your hands as often as possible if your kids get sick too, as you don’t want them to bring home germs from other children and contaminate your home.

Losing track of these tips to improve your wellbeing is quite easy if you’re not paying attention, which may end up jeopardizing your health in the long run. By changing your routine, you’ll be more accustomed to doing things differently so that these changes become part of your regular routine.
